Step 1: Understanding the Question:
The task is to recall and write four consecutive lines from any poem in the prescribed syllabus, ensuring they are not already printed in the exam paper.
Step 2: Choosing a Poem:
A simple and memorable choice is "Dust of Snow" by Robert Frost.
Step 3: Writing the Lines:
The following four lines are from the poem "Dust of Snow" by Robert Frost:

The way a crow
Shook down on me
The dust of snow
From a hemlock tree
